**Ticket OPS-4417: Connection failures during cold starts**

Glintworks serverless handlers fail to connect on cold start roughly 4% of invocations. Root cause: pool initialization races the secrets fetch, and retries hit the pooler cap. Mitigation: lazy pool init plus jittered retry. No credentials are logged. For verification, the handler connects using the string below.

primary connection of yagep-kahip = redis://giliel_svc:zYiKsLL2PLpfPL@db-348f.xolmarsys.corp:5432/fenwyn

## Deployment

The ShoalCast tide-table widget ships as a self-contained bundle. Plugin authors should deploy it behind the host page's asset pipeline, never inline, so version pinning works. The widget reads station data from the harmonic endpoint at load and caches predictions locally for six hours. Before publishing a plugin, verify your target environment matches the reference configuration below.

service settings:
PRAIX_LOG_LEVEL=error
PRAIX_METRICS_HOST=metrics.praix.qorvelcorp.corp
PRAIX_POOL_SIZE=16

## Env vars for Lintelle component library versioning

Quick notes before the sync: the publish pipeline reads everything from `.env.release`, not CI secrets anymore (long story, ask Priya-from-platform... kidding, invented Priya). `LINTELLE_CHANNEL` picks canary vs stable, `LINTELLE_BUMP` controls semver math, and the changelog bot reads `LINTELLE_NOTES_DIR`. Don't hand-edit version tags; the bot reverts them. One more thing: publishing to the Orrin package registry needs a publish token, and it sits on the next line.

env line for fafof-fahag: LEDGER_TOKEN5=f8790

Finance Review Summary — Kestrelline Term Sheet

Quick read for the board: Kestrelline Partners has sent over a term sheet for the Orvana joint venture, and honestly it's better than we expected. They're offering 60/40 capital split in our favour, a three-year exclusivity on the Tessmore corridor, and a buyout option at year five. Catches: governance tilts their way on procurement, and the indemnity cap is thin. Our counsel at Bryce & Fallow is marking it up now. Full strategic context sits in the confidential note below.

board note of fafog-yahap: Project Rusdor slips by a full year because of the audit delay.